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9009 6349 220397190 2868561 7854821
95 93 899585964
95 93 899585964
80240441811 661331479 37 5441268 73
All about undefined
Interested in learning more?
95 93 899585964
80240441811 661331479 37 5441268 73
See more
17957131314 72668
1038273 54 428907746
See more
9192836994 604326446 504939773
4141423 7533 84214331
See more